ikinjanja

Word parts: iki-njanja

ee-kee-NJAH-njah

How to say it

Kirundiikinjanjaee-kee-NJAH-njahsoon
Englishtrivetsoon
Frenchtrépiedsoon

Meaning

a piece of metal set on stones over a fire to support a cooking pot.

Good to know

class 7/8 noun; used in traditional open-fire cooking.

Examples

  • Nushire inkono ku kinjanja.Put the pot on the trivet.
  • Ikinjanja kirahagaze he?Where is the trivet standing?
  • Ntawe afise ikinjanja muri iyi nzu.No one has a trivet in this house.
  • Tuzokora ikinjanja gishasha.We will make a new trivet.
